Sumitomo Mitsui Trust Holdings Inc. decreased its holdings in MarketAxess Holdings Inc. (NASDAQ:MKTX – Free Report) by 0.9% in the 4th quarter, according to its most recent 13F filing with the Securities and Exchange Commission (SEC). The firm owned 91,542 shares of the financial services provider’s stock after selling 802 shares during the quarter. Sumitomo Mitsui Trust Holdings Inc. owned approximately 0.24% of MarketAxess worth $26,808,000 at the end of the most recent quarter.

Insider Buying and Selling
In other MarketAxess news, CRO Kevin M. Mcpherson sold 2,000 shares of the company’s stock in a transaction that occurred on Friday, February 16th. The stock was sold at an average price of $221.26, for a total value of $442,520.00. Following the transaction, the executive now directly owns 70,092 shares of the company’s stock, valued at approximately $15,508,555.92. The sale was disclosed in a filing with the SEC, which is accessible through the SEC website. 2.00% of the stock is currently owned by corporate insiders.

MarketAxess Stock Performance
MarketAxess stock opened at $204.01 on Monday. The stock’s 50 day moving average price is $216.43 and its 200 day moving average price is $237.73. The firm has a market capitalization of $7.67 billion, a PE ratio of 29.78, a price-to-earnings-growth ratio of 4.26 and a beta of 0.98. MarketAxess Holdings Inc. has a one year low of $199.34 and a one year high of $336.56.
MarketAxess (NASDAQ:MKTX – Get Free Report) last released its quarterly earnings results on Wednesday, January 31st. The financial services provider reported $1.84 EPS for the quarter, topping the consensus estimate of $1.73 by $0.11. The firm had revenue of $197.20 million for the quarter, compared to analyst estimates of $196.70 million. MarketAxess had a return on equity of 21.76% and a net margin of 34.29%. MarketAxess’s revenue for the quarter was up 10.8% on a year-over-year basis. During the same period in the previous year, the company posted $1.58 EPS. On average, analysts forecast that MarketAxess Holdings Inc. will post 7.28 earnings per share for the current fiscal year.
